🤖 Smart Vending Machines: Revolutionizing Self-Service Retail 🛒✨


🥤 What if buying your favorite snack, beverage, or everyday essentials took just a few seconds—with cashless payments, touchless access, and real-time inventory?

Smart vending machines are transforming the retail experience by combining automation, AI, IoT, and digital payments to deliver faster, more convenient, and personalized shopping.

📖 History & Origin

Traditional vending machines have been around for over a century, primarily dispensing snacks and beverages. With the advancement of Artificial Intelligence (AI), the Internet of Things (IoT), cloud computing, and cashless payment technologies, modern Smart Vending Machines emerged as intelligent retail solutions. Today, they are widely used in airports, hospitals, offices, schools, shopping malls, hotels, and public spaces, offering everything from food and beverages to electronics, cosmetics, and healthcare products.

🏪 Types of Smart Vending Machines

🔹 Food & Beverage Vending Machines

  • Dispense snacks, drinks, fresh meals, and healthy food options.

🔹 Retail Vending Machines

  • Offer electronics, accessories, cosmetics, and lifestyle products.

🔹 Pharmaceutical & Healthcare Vending Machines

  • Provide over-the-counter healthcare products and personal care essentials where permitted.

🔹 Smart Locker Vending Systems

  • Enable automated order pickup and secure parcel collection.

🔹 AI-Powered Grab-and-Go Machines

  • Use computer vision and smart sensors for seamless product selection and checkout.

⚙️ Technology & Key Features

Smart vending machines are equipped with:

📱 Touchscreen digital displays

🌐 IoT connectivity for remote monitoring

🤖 AI-powered inventory and customer analytics

💳 Cashless payment systems (cards, mobile wallets, QR codes)

📡 Smart sensors and automated dispensing technology

☁️ Cloud-based management platforms

⭐ Key Features

  • Real-time inventory tracking

  • Contactless and cashless transactions

  • Remote diagnostics and maintenance

  • Personalized promotions and digital advertising

  • Fast, secure, and user-friendly shopping experience

✅ Benefits of Smart Vending Machines

✔️ Provide 24/7 self-service convenience

✔️ Reduce operational costs through automation

✔️ Improve inventory management with real-time monitoring

✔️ Enhance customer experience with multiple payment options

✔️ Generate valuable business insights through data analytics

💡 Care & Usage Tips

🧼 Clean touchscreens, dispensing areas, and product compartments regularly to maintain hygiene.

📦 Restock products on time to avoid stockouts and improve customer satisfaction.

🔄 Keep software and firmware updated for optimal performance and security.

📡 Monitor network connectivity to ensure uninterrupted remote management.

🔍 Schedule preventive maintenance to inspect sensors, payment systems, and dispensing mechanisms.

A useful point in discussions about professional development is that formal education and practical experience do not always progress at the same pace. Someone may have spent years building expertise in a particular role without following a traditional university route, yet still need a structured qualification to demonstrate that knowledge. This is where understanding how an education level 7 qualification fits within the wider framework can be helpful, particularly for professionals considering advanced study alongside employment. It can also be worth looking beyond the qualification title and checking the learning outcomes, assessment methods, and how closely the subject content relates to current responsibilities. For working professionals, flexibility matters as well, since a course that can be integrated around existing commitments may be more sustainable than one requiring a complete career pause. Another consideration is how the qualification supports the next stage rather than simply adding another credential to a CV. Looking at progression routes, professional recognition, and the skills developed during the programme can provide a clearer picture of its long-term value.
